About 10 Elm Way
10 Elm Way is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Boreham, Chelmsford, Chelmsford (CM3 3HD). It has a recorded floor area of 65 m² (around 700 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(October 2024) shows an E (score 46),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. When first surveyed in May 2018 the rating was F,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 84), a 3-band jump. The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.
A recent sale: £337,500 in July 2025. At 65 m² it's 20.4% larger than the typical home in the postcode (54 m² median across 16 EPCs). It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 88% of similar EPCs). Across 2018–2025, sale prices on this property compounded at 2.8%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£482/sq ft) was about 45.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. One historical planning record sits against the property in 2026.
